Our Parking Lot Coordinators play an integral part of daily operations ensuring the smooth flow of operations at our facility, as well as assisting our guests during the check-in and check-out process.

Requirements

  • High school education or equivalent
  • Previous customer service experience preferred
  • Valid driver’s license is required at all times
  • Currently holds and is able to maintain a satisfactory driving record in accordance with the Employee Handbook
  • Ability to verbally communicate clearly in the English language for safety purposes
  • Ability to work in inclement weather
  • Ability to stand for most of the shift and safely lift up to 30 pounds with or without an accommodation

Responsibilities

  • Greet each customer in a friendly and professional manner
  • Provide clear directions and answer guest questions about the facility, airport and our operations
  • Observe activities at the parking facility, including any issues with guest vehicles, trip hazards, etc. and report any suspicious activity to Management
  • May maintain and monitor surveillance camera system inside office communicating with on-duty security
  • May dispatch shuttles to maintain ample coverage at the facility and at the airport
  • Direct proper movement of parking lot activities including shuttle movement, Shuttle Driver breaks, and shuttle fueling schedules
  • Cooperate with all team members to provide the best possible service to all internal and external customers
  • May cross-train for other frontline positions as directed by management
  • Maintain accurate familiarity with the airport terminals and general area to answer questions and provide helpful information to guests
  • Perform additional duties as reasonably requested by Management
